Used ground beef, canned corn, medium salsa, black olives, egg noodles, pinto beans (didn't have kidney), homade taco seasoning 1 (from this site), 1 8oz can tomato sauce with basil and oregano and 1/2 cup water. What a great recipe to make to your liking or to use what you have on hand. I didn't bake it, just threw together on top of the stove. This makes a lot of dinner. I can't believe that 1/4th of this is 1 serving because 3 of us ate and we still have some leftovers.
